    The magic wand tool is probably easier than the lasoo if the area you want to select is well defined!! You can play around with the levels of the magic wand but it can be tricky to get the right amount. Give it a go you might be suprised how well it works!!
    Magnetic lasoo is probably better than the lasoo also - the normal lasoo your using freehand and sometimes looks dodgy and not too smart (IMO). The magnetic lasoo will at least "grab" onto the border/outline of the object your trying to select.
